Claims
- 1. In a thermal battery having a plurality of single cell pellets arranged in a stack, with each single cell comprising a heat pellet and two current collectors, an anode pellet, a separator pellet, and a cathode pellet, the improvement wherein said cathode material comprises a system compatible chromium (V) compound.
- 2. A thermal battery according to claim 1, wherein said chromium (V) compound is Ca.sub.5 (CrO.sub.4).sub.3 Cl, Ca.sub.2 CrO.sub.4 Cl, Ca.sub.5 (CrO.sub.4).sub.3 OH, Ca.sub.3 (CrO.sub.4).sub.2 or Cr.sub.2 O.sub.5.
- 3. A thermal battery according to claim 1, wherein said cathode portion further coprises a LiCl/KCl eutectic as binder and wetting agent.
- 4. A thermal battery according to claim 1, wherein said cathode portion consists of substantially pure chromium (V) compound.
- 5. A thermal battery according to claim 3, wherein the amount of said LiCl/KCl eutectic is about 10-30% by weight of the cathode and the amount of chromium (V) compound is about 70-90% by weight.
- 6. A thermal battery according to claim 1, wherein said chromium (V) compound is an oxygen-containing chromium (V) compound.
- 7. A thermal battery according to claim 1, wherein said chromium (V) compound is an alkaline earth metal salt.
